Smart Assembly started in SMAC’s early machine assembly days. The first application was for a micro capacitor discharge assembly used for CRT TVs.
The individual parts had a large tolerance variation but the final assembly demanded accurate dimensions which presented a problem with tolerance stack-up.
The successful solution was to measure all critical dimensions and adjust the final part locations accordingly.
A variant of this was used in SMC pilot valve assembly machines, which presented the same problems with large tolerances, this time from moulded plastic parts used due to cost.
The final assembly was centred around 1/3 of allowable variation which guaranteed that the part was always in tolerance.
Modern applications of Smart Assembly are mobile phone lens assembly for Apple and Samsung and a syringe assembly OEM that won an award at the recent PACK assembly.
